#ifndef SKETCHERGUI_DrawSketchHandlerPoint_H
#define SKETCHERGUI_DrawSketchHandlerPoint_H
#include "GeometryCreationMode.h"
namespace SketcherGui {
extern GeometryCreationMode geometryCreationMode; // defined in CommandCreateGeo.cpp
class DrawSketchHandlerPoint: public DrawSketchHandler
{
public:
DrawSketchHandlerPoint() : selectionDone(false) {}
virtual ~DrawSketchHandlerPoint() {}
void mouseMove(Base::Vector2d onSketchPos) override
{
setPositionText(onSketchPos);
if (seekAutoConstraint(sugConstr, onSketchPos, Base::Vector2d(0.f,0.f))) {
renderSuggestConstraintsCursor(sugConstr);
return;
}
applyCursor();
}
bool pressButton(Base::Vector2d onSketchPos) override
{
EditPoint = onSketchPos;
selectionDone = true;
return true;
}
bool releaseButton(Base::Vector2d onSketchPos) override
{
Q_UNUSED(onSketchPos);
if (selectionDone){
unsetCursor();
resetPositionText();
try {
Gui::Command::openCommand(QT_TRANSLATE_NOOP("Command", "Add sketch point"));
Gui::cmdAppObjectArgs(sketchgui->getObject(), "addGeometry(Part.Point(App.Vector(%f,%f,0)))",
EditPoint.x,EditPoint.y);
Gui::Command::commitCommand();
}
catch (const Base::Exception& e) {
Base::Console().Error("Failed to add point: %s\n", e.what());
Gui::Command::abortCommand();
}
// add auto constraints for the line segment start
if (!sugConstr.empty()) {
createAutoConstraints(sugConstr, getHighestCurveIndex(), Sketcher::PointPos::start);
sugConstr.clear();
}
tryAutoRecomputeIfNotSolve(static_cast<Sketcher::SketchObject *>(sketchgui->getObject()));
ParameterGrp::handle hGrp = App::GetApplication().GetParameterGroupByPath("User parameter:BaseApp/Preferences/Mod/Sketcher");
bool continuousMode = hGrp->GetBool("ContinuousCreationMode",true);
if(continuousMode){
// This code enables the continuous creation mode.
applyCursor();
/* It is ok not to call to purgeHandler
* in continuous creation mode because the
* handler is destroyed by the quit() method on pressing the
* right button of the mouse */
}
else{
sketchgui->purgeHandler(); // no code after this line, Handler get deleted in ViewProvider
}
}
return true;
}
private:
QString getCrosshairCursorSVGName() const override
{
return QString::fromLatin1("Sketcher_Pointer_Create_Point");
}
protected:
bool selectionDone;
Base::Vector2d EditPoint;
std::vector<AutoConstraint> sugConstr;
};
} // namespace SketcherGui
#endif // SKETCHERGUI_DrawSketchHandlerPoint_H
